Default 07 Superglide security info

I picked up a wrecked 07 superglide with no keys or FOB. The dealer ordered a set of keys and informed me it came with a security system from the factory. I am reading a few different things and was hoping to get it cleared up. Is it as simple as getting the FOB programmed at Harley? Or will have to buy a new Security module and ECM? There was no Speedometer but I have one on the way. Not sure about the pin.

Have you checked whether the bikes starts when you put your new key in?
Although it may have come with a security module installed , it would need to have been set up during pre delivery inspection and it might be that the security was not set up depending on customers request.
The turn signal security module is located under the left hand side panel and will have a part number on it.
If the security is turned on and you have no fob or PIN, then short of trying to contact the selling dealer with proof of ownership or previous owner if possible, you will need a new security module, or just a turn signal module without security.
